Crispy Tortilla Crust BBQ Pulled Pork and Bacon Pizza

Fajita size Tortilla 


Toppings

BBQ sauce

Fine grated Parmesan 

Pulled pork

Bacon bits

Thin sliced sweet Onions 

Thin sliced Sweet peppers

Grated Mozzarella 

Heavy cream

Drizzle olive oil


Lay out a piece of foil

Spray with nonstick 

Add tortillas 

Spray top of tortillas with non stick

Take 1 t of BBQ sauce and spread over tortillas 

Lightly sprinkle Parmesan 

Add pork, bacon, onions, peppers and drizzle oil

Mix mozzarella and 1 t heavy cream and top pizza

Preheat air fryer 450 degrees for 3 minutes 

Add foil and pizza

Cook 6 minutes 

Cut and serve

White Chocolate Walnut Pie

2 regular pie shells

Thaw and poke holes in dough


1-1/2 c chopped walnuts, set aside


White melting wafers, just to cover bottom of shell


Filling ingredients 

1 c white sugar

3 large beaten eggs

1/2 c light Karo syrup 

1/4 melted butter, cooled

1 t cinnamon 

1 t vanilla extract

1 t Molasses 


Whisk beaten eggs and sugar together

Add the rest of filling ingredients 

Whisk well

Add walnuts

Cover bottom of shell with white chocolate wafers

Add filling and nuts

Bake preheated 375 degree for 40 minutes 

Cool before serving

Top with spray whip topping

Bacon Mushroom Serrano Potato Casserole

6 medium Yukon Gold Potatoes, microwave 3 minutes each side or until potatoes are soft, slice into 1/8 inch thick rounds to cool, peel or not according to your preference 


1 c real bacon bits, microwave 1 minute

Set aside


1 t Oil

1 t Butter

2 T roasted Garlic

1/2 c sliced Leeks

1/2 of a chopped Serrano

1 c sliced Mushrooms 

1 t Chicken base seasoning 

1/2 t Sugar 

1/2 t Pepper

1 t basil

1 t oregano 

1/2 t Salt

2 c Heavy Cream

1 c Parmesan cheese


Using a medium pot

Sauté veggies in butter oil mixture 

Add seasonings 

Add cream and sauté 5 minutes until slightly thickened 


To build

13x9 pan

Layer 1/3 of potatoes in pan

Spoon 1/3 of cream mix

Spoon 1/3 of bacon

Repeat 2 more times 

Add Parmesan to top

Cover with foil

Air fry 20 minutes 

Uncover and cook an additional 5 minutes 

Serve


BBQ Dust Chicken Thighs Oven Steamed

BBQ Dust

1/2 c brown sugar

2 T paprika

1 T smoked paprika 

1/2 T coarse black pepper 

1 T coarse kosher salt

1 T garlic granules 

1 T onion powder 

1 t mustard powder

1/2 t cayenne pepper 


Lightly cover both sides of boneless skinless thighs


6 seasoned boneless skinless chicken thighs 

3 c water

Dutch oven

Ramekin 

Small plate


Add water to Dutch oven 

Place ramekin in middle, add plate to top

Stack seasoned thighs on plate

Add lid

Bring to light boil

Put in a preheated 350 oven for 55 minutes or until stack of thighs reaches 165 degrees 

To serve slice, chop or pull chicken

Greek Chicken Stir Fry for Two

Prep 

1 c Rotisserie chicken breast, chopped

1 small onion, sliced 

1 c chopped broccoli florets (can sub Zucchini) 

3 t olive oil, divided

Set aside


Sauce

1/2 of a lemon juiced

1 t dried oregano 

3/4 t Dijon

3/4 t salt

3/4 t pepper

1/2 c salsa ( can sub cherry tomatoes)

1/4 c full fat cottage cheese ( can sub feta)

Make sauce and set aside


Add ins

1/2 c hominy, can sub Garbanzo beans)

3 T juice from hominy or beans

1/4 c Castelvetrano olives 

1/8 C capers

1 t fresh chopped dill


In a large skillet over medium heat, add 

1 t oil and stir fry onions, broccoli and chicken until onions are tender, add more oil if necessary 

Add sauce and stir fry for 3 minutes

Add the add ins

Stir fry another 2-3 minutes 

Remove from heat and add fresh dill

Serve
